Welcome to AT 8000 Series Tire Pressure Monitoring System (TPMS). This Fast installation Guide is intended to give you a fast overview of the key steps required to install your AT 8000 Serial TPMS. For more detailed information, please refer to the 8000 Serial TPMS Installation Guide. Installation steps: Step 1: Check components Step 2: Check identification number Each sensor should be assigned a unique identification number (ID), which was marked on the top of sensor. Step 3: Enable and Test sensors before installing To enable a sensor, it is only needed to pull out the jumper attached on sensor. After successfully enabled, sensor will start to measure environment air pressure and temperature and send them to receiver. Step 4: Set up the receiver Plug the attached power cord into Receiver and insert the other terminal to the cigarette electrical socket of vehicle. You can adjust parameters of receiver according to your requirement. Only the first two and last four digitals of ID will show on panel of receiver, for example, if ID is 34125678, only345678 will be shown. Step 5: Installing one sensor into wheel Please get help from professional tire shops if necessary. 1. Remove the wheel from vehicle, Deflate, and separate rim and tire. 2. Fix sensor on rim. 3. Assemble rim and tire, inflate to typical pressures. 4. Balance wheel and install to vehicle. 5. Use receiver to search ID of this wheel again, and assign this ID to the position respect to this tire installation. Make sure that the sensor inside tire was keeping work well. Steps 6: Continue to install all other sensors with the same procedure. Install all tires to the right positions of vehicle. Using receiver to search and assign all IDs to correct position respect to tire installation. Steps 7: Setup pressure and temperature thresholds according to tire type. Do not mix up each tire’s ID, or the detected tire parameter may not be correct! It is easy to identify each tier’s ID by changing its pressure (slightly deflate) and monitor the receiver for checking this pressure variation and tire position. Check all recorded tire IDs by press Key 1. Each single press on Key 1 can call one tire parameters out, including temperature, pressure, and identification code. Continually press on Key 1 can read tire parameters one by one. Typical torque of new valve nut is 3~5 N-m(30~50 kgf-cm). In order to guarantee sealing, be sure that the rubber rings are properly positioned between rim and valve.
